Title:
  Gedit embedded terminal font color almost the same as background color

Status in “gedit-plugins” package in Ubuntu:
  New

Bug description:
  Due to similarity of the font color and background color the gedit
  embedded terminal (from package gedit-plugins) is unreadable. On some
  displays it looks as if it doesnt work.

  Workaround:
  -run dconf-editor
  -go to org->gnome->plugins
  -uncheck option "use-theme-colors"
